That may lead to Mikel Arteta agreeing to part company with Belgium international Trossard. The 29-year-old forward has been at Emirates Stadium since completing a £20m ($26m) transfer from Brighton in January 2023 – with 19 goals recorded through 70 appearances in all competitions.

According to Fabrizio Romano, Trossard is now being lined up for a big-money move to the Middle East. He claims that Al-Ittihad have a formal offer on the table ahead of the summer transfer deadline passing for teams in the Saudi Pro League. Arsenal are now mulling over whether to cash in or not.

If Trossard were to be offloaded, then he would join a star-studded squad in Jeddah. Al-Ittihad already have Ballon d’Or-winning former Real Madrid striker Karim Benzema on their books, along with ex-Chelsea midfielder N’Golo Kante, one-time Liverpool star Fabinho and Algeria international playmaker Houssem Aouar.
